Immunizations
The process of making a person immune to infectious diseases, typically by the administration of vaccines.
Obstetrician
A medical doctor specializing in the care of women during pregnancy, childbirth, and the postpartum period.
Pregnant
The state of carrying a developing embryo or fetus within the female body.
Neural-Tube Defect
A birth defect involving incomplete development of the brain, spinal cord, or their protective coverings.
